    That is a horrible example. Part of the problem is that the UFC itself doesn’t always accurately represent fighting. The style you talked about is probably the most effective way to get a real win i the ufc. However it is boring to many fight fans and has been pushed out.

    You described a Jon fitch fight or a Ben Askren fight. Ironically, a Brock Lesnar and a DC fight. When guys win like that they are generally not pushed like the Mike Perry’s of the world. God forbid they lose 1 they are cut. However if you fight like Perry, Diego Sanchez or Leonard Garcia you can lose 4 or even 5 b4 you are cut.

    So although a style of winning (which btw is made difficult to do against skilled opponents) isn’t aesthetically pleasing the style you mentioned is irl the most dominant style.

    You want more proof. Watch a guy who is 1 loss away from being cut. Watch how he fights.

                  When I first started playing UFC 3, the jab, straights were difficult to counter - especially vs Diaz in the beta.

                  After persevering in ranked and quick match "stand and bang" - I now want to play vs people who will do this, because I now know exactly how to punish it.

                  Do what I did with jab, straights, but do it with body kicks and leg kicks - BTW, no competent player should be complaining of leg kick spam or body kick spam. They're literally the easiest things to counter in this game, apart from maybe a poorly timed single leg.
